d998477a88 refactor(test-gen): improve codebase test generator to produce passing tests with edge cases

- Generate both main and edge case tests for each coverage gap
- Use MagicMock for complex unknown arguments to avoid crashes
- Fix async test generation (async def, await calls)
- Remove placeholder tautology assertions; tests now verify execution
- Fix args.max_tests bug

Generated tests now pass (0 failures) and include real edge coverage.

#!/usr/bin/env python3
"""
Cross-agent quality audit — #518
Fetches all PRs across Timmy_Foundation repos, classifies by agent,
and produces a merge-rate scorecard.
Usage:
python scripts/cross_agent_quality_audit.py
python scripts/cross_agent_quality_audit.py --scorecard timmy-config/agent-quality-scorecard.md
"""
import argparse
import json
import os
import re
import sys
from collections import defaultdict
from datetime import datetime, timezone
from pathlib import Path
from typing import Any, Dict, List, Optional
import requests
GITEA_BASE = "https://forge.alexanderwhitestone.com/api/v1"
ORG = "Timmy_Foundation"
TOKEN = os.environ.get("GITEA_TOKEN") or (
Path.home() / ".config" / "gitea" / "token"
).read_text().strip()
HEADERS = {"Authorization": f"token {TOKEN}"}
# Repos to audit (active code repos)
DEFAULT_REPOS = [
"timmy-home",
"hermes-agent",
"the-nexus",
"the-door",
"fleet-ops",
"burn-fleet",
"the-playground",
"compounding-intelligence",
"the-beacon",
"second-son-of-timmy",
"timmy-academy",
"timmy-config",
]
class AgentClassifier:
"""Classify PRs by agent identity."""
# PR title prefixes that explicitly name an agent
AGENT_TITLE_RE = re.compile(
r"^\[(?P<agent>Claude|Ezra|Allegro|Bezalel|Timmy|Gemini|Kimi|Manus|Codex)\]",
re.IGNORECASE,
)
# Branch patterns that embed agent names
AGENT_BRANCH_RE = re.compile(
r"(?P<agent>claude|ezra|allegro|bezalel|timmy|gemini|kimi|manus|codex)",
re.IGNORECASE,
)
@classmethod
def classify(cls, pr: Dict[str, Any]) -> str:
title = pr.get("title", "")
branch = pr.get("head", {}).get("ref", "")
user = pr.get("user", {}).get("login", "")
# 1. Explicit title tag like [Claude] or [Ezra]
m = cls.AGENT_TITLE_RE.match(title)
if m:
return m.group("agent").lower()
# 2. Branch contains agent name (e.g. claude/issue-123)
m = cls.AGENT_BRANCH_RE.search(branch)
if m:
return m.group("agent").lower()
# 3. Git user mapping
if user.lower() == "claude":
return "claude"
if user.lower() == "rockachopa":
# Rockachopa is the human / orchestrator — map to "burn-loop"
return "burn-loop"
return "unknown"
def fetch_prs(repo: str, state: str = "all", per_page: int = 50) -> List[Dict[str, Any]]:
"""Paginate through all PRs for a repo."""
prs: List[Dict[str, Any]] = []
page = 1
while True:
url = f"{GITEA_BASE}/repos/{ORG}/{repo}/pulls?state={state}&limit={per_page}&page={page}"
resp = requests.get(url, headers=HEADERS, timeout=30)
resp.raise_for_status()
batch = resp.json()
if not batch:
break
prs.extend(batch)
if len(batch) < per_page:
break
page += 1
return prs

## Methodology
- **Agent classification** uses three signals in priority order:
1. Explicit title tag (e.g. `[Claude]`, `[Ezra]`)
2. Branch name containing agent name (e.g. `claude/issue-123`)
3. Git user (`claude` → claude, `Rockachopa` → burn-loop)
- **Merge rate** = merged / (merged + closed_unmerged). Open PRs are excluded.
- **Rejection rate** = closed_unmerged / (merged + closed_unmerged).
- **Time metrics** are computed from created_at to merged_at / closed_at.
